How do I edit an existing Incident in PowerSchool for State Reporting in Vermont?

Introduction

After the initial Incident has been entered, if a data element was missed, the EdFusion state error reports will identify what is missing.

Incident Categories

Depending on what data element is the issue, there are four Incident Element Categories to choose from.

  • Action
    • The “Action” or consequence for the Incident.
  • Object
    • The item used in the Incident. (If applicable)
  • Behavior
    • What happened in the Incident. i.e. Insubordination, illegal behavior.
  • Attribute
    • Encompasses a variety of data elements. i.e. Criminal Offense, Violence Related, Weapon.

There are three options when editing an Incident.

  1. Adding an Element under Incident Element.
  2. Editing an Element under Participants (Incident Builder).
    • Typically for Victims and Offenders
  3. Editing an Element under Incident Elements
    • Typically for Victims and Offenders

    1 – Adding an Element (under Incident Elements)

    Click the green + sign to the right of Incident Elements > select the desired Element.

    Once the Element has been completed. Save, then drag to the applicable section under Participants.

    2 – Edit an Incident (under Participants)

    3 – Edit an Incident (under Incident Elements)

    To EDIT: Hover over the to edit or add information to that person or incident element.

    • Victim name or Offender Name – Participant (person)
    • Behavior (hand)
    • Action (star)

    Victim or Offender Element

    Click on the pencil icon to the right. This will open the Participant Attribute.

    Depending on what Attribute is selected, a second dropdown may appear. Complete as applicable and click Update Participant Attributes.

    Behavior (hand)

    Click on the pencil icon to the right. This will open the Behavior.

    Note: There must be a Primary Behavior selected.

    Action (star)

    Click on the pencil icon to the right. This will open the Action (consequence).

    Adding a Participant (Person)

    If you need to add a Participant > use the green + sign to the right of Incident Builder.

    Once the Element has been completed. Save then drag to the applicable section underneath.

    Be sure to save along the way.
